Armenian Dram Overview
The Armenian Dram (AMD) is the official currency of Armenia. The currency strengthened dramatically in 2022-2023 when over 100,000 Russian relocants brought massive foreign currency inflows. Jordanian Dinar Overview
The Jordanian Dinar (JOD) is the official currency of Jordan, pegged to the US Dollar. Despite limited natural resources, the dinar maintains its peg through international aid and remittances. The JOD exchange rate against AMD reflects relative economic conditions between the two currency areas.
Mid-Market Rate Explained
The mid-market rate of 1 AMD = 0.001926 JOD shown on this page is the fairest available exchange rate. It sits exactly between the buy and sell prices quoted by major financial institutions. No single provider can offer exactly the mid-market rate since their business model requires a small spread, but the best providers come within 0.5-1% of this benchmark.
